Manchester United must pay €20m to secure summer signing

Manchester United must pay €20m to secure the permanent signing of Bayern Munich midfielder Marcel Sabitzer.

Sabizter signed for Manchester United during the January transfer window as a replacement for the injured Christian Eriksen. The Austrian international signed on an initial loan deal until the end of the season.

With Bayern willing to allow Sabitzer to leave in the middle of the season on a loan deal, you’d imagine it wouldn’t take too much to convince the German club to part ways permanently.

Now, speaking to BILD, Christian Falk has claimed that it would take around €20m for Manchester United to sign Sabitzer on a permanent deal.
